How to Choose a Professional Detailer

Selecting a professional detailer is not an easy task. It’s unsettling but true – many may call themselves professionals but they do not stand up to or beyond the industry standards and lack customer commitment. When contracting the services of a professional detailer it should be approached no differently than if you were hiring a contractor for your house.

A vehicle is the second largest investment for most people – a major asset. So you don’t want amateur detailers performing work on it. You want a detailer that is a true professional. Someone who possess knowledge about the chemicals, equipment and the various surfaces of each vehicle.

A person who constantly updates their professional skills, education and training to keep pace with the ever changing technology. Your car care guardian should be committed to customer satisfaction and a superior craftsman. Here are a few tips to help you when looking for that diamond in the rough.

Educate yourself

Gain as much information and knowledge as you can about car care prior to consulting any auto detailing services.

Ask around town

Inquire with friends, family, co-workers and automotive dealerships to find out who is the best automotive detailer in or close to town. Automotive dealerships are your best bet – they are in the business and know the value of a fine detailer.

Ask questions

Once you have expanded your knowledge you will be able to ask questions. Find out what options are available to you, ask what the differences are between their service and the competitors, ask about their customer satisfaction policy, prices, the benefits and how they define themselves as a professional.

View a car before and after

Ask the detailer if you may see a car prior to being detailed and again after the work has been completed. Do not go by photos. Ask to see the real deal. It may be a little time consuming because you will have to go to the shop twice but it is well worth it.

Ask for references

Don’t be afraid to ask a detailer prior to contracting them for several references. If they are unwilling to provide any – stay clear. A true professional has excellent references and is more than willing to provide them upon request.

Follow through

Before committing to any services follow through on the references. Ask the reference if they were satisfied with the work performed, what type of service they purchased, if they have had any problems – if so, was it rectified in a timely and favorable way. Ask when the work was performed – if it was just performed ask if you can see it.

Make a decision

It’s now time to make an intelligent decision based on your knowledge. Remember, basing your decision on pricing alone is not enough. Auto detailing is protection for your asset. In general, prices reflect the quality of workmanship. Lower quotes usually mean lower – chemical quality, care, client satisfaction, craftsmanship and overall knowledge, training and education. A true professional does not reduce prices to compete because the quality of work provided supersedes that of the competitors and is above the industry standards.
